The onset of winter with the darkest day of the year is also seen as the first ray of hope by the most diverse cultures and religions around the world: People move closer together, reflect on shared traditions, and make encounters attentive and loving. In the dark season, numerous festivals of light around the world emphasize communal solidarity and human interaction: the Christian Christmas, the Jewish Hanuka, the Thai Loy Krathong, the Chinese lantern festival Tangyuan, the Hindu Divali. We celebrate the Festival of Lights and Encounters in the Luther Church with musical representatives of the three great religions.
The Sound of ONE
The Sound of ONE project is a fascinating combination of music, literature and spirituality and highlights the diversity of Anatolian and Mesopotamian cultures. The interplay of traditional and modern elements not only honors the rich heritage of these regions, but also promotes an innovative cultural dialogue.
The inclusion of different ethnic and religious musical styles, such as Zazaic, Kurdish and Armenian songs, as well as religious music from Alevi, Sephardic and Yazidi traditions, offers a comprehensive perspective on the musical practices of these communities. The use of traditional instruments in combination with Western classical instruments and jazz creates a unique soundscape that reinforces both the cultural identity and emotional expression of the pieces.
The integration of poets such as Rumi, Ahmadi Khani and Fuzuli into the project deepens the understanding of the spiritual and mystical dimensions of music. Their works, which often deal with themes such as love, longing and the pursuit of the divine, can be an important source of inspiration for the musical arrangements and performances.
